Alcaraz Makes History with 50th Win of 2025: Is He Unstoppable?

Carlos Alcaraz has achieved a remarkable feat in the world of tennis, securing his 50th win of 2025 at the Cincinnati Open. This milestone marks the fourth consecutive year that Alcaraz has reached 50 wins in a calendar year, solidifying his position as one of the most dominant players in the sport. The Spanish athlete's victory over Hamad Medjedovic at the Cincinnati Open was a testament to his skill and perseverance, leaving fans and critics alike wondering if he is unstoppable.
